RouterQuery Engine
In this notebook we will look into RouterQueryEngine to route the user queries to one of the available query engine tools. These tools can be different indices/ query engine on same documents/ different documents.

Load Document
# load documents
from llama_index.core import SimpleDirectoryReader
documents = SimpleDirectoryReader("data/paul_graham").load_data()Create Indices and Query Engines.
from llama_index.core import SummaryIndex, VectorStoreIndex
# Summary Index for summarization questions
summary_index = SummaryIndex.from_documents(documents)
# Vector Index for answering specific context questions
vector_index = VectorStoreIndex.from_documents(documents)# Summary Index Query Engine
summary_query_engine = summary_index.as_query_engine(
response_mode="tree_summarize",
use_async=True,
)
# Vector Index Query Engine
vector_query_engine = vector_index.as_query_engine()Create tools for summary and vector query engines.
from llama_index.core.tools.query_engine import QueryEngineTool
# Summary Index tool
summary_tool = QueryEngineTool.from_defaults(
query_engine=summary_query_engine,
description="Useful for summarization questions related to Paul Graham eassy on What I Worked On.",
)
# Vector Index tool
vector_tool = QueryEngineTool.from_defaults(
query_engine=vector_query_engine,
description="Useful for retrieving specific context from Paul Graham essay on What I Worked On.",
)Create Router Query Engine
from llama_index.core.query_engine.router_query_engine import RouterQueryEngine
from llama_index.core.selectors.llm_selectors import LLMSingleSelector# Create Router Query Engine
query_engine = RouterQueryEngine(
selector=LLMSingleSelector.from_defaults(),
query_engine_tools=[
summary_tool,
vector_tool,
],
)Test Queries
response = query_engine.query("What is the summary of the document?")HTTP Request: POST https://api.anthropic.com/v1/messages "HTTP/1.1 200 OK"
Selecting query engine 0: The question is asking for a summary of the document. Choice 1 specifically mentions that it is useful for summarization questions related to Paul Graham's essay on What I Worked On, making it the most relevant choice for answering the given question..
